Navigating Grief and Loss as a Family

Grief is a universal human experience, and it can be particularly challenging to navigate when shared within a family. When faced with the loss of a loved one, families often find themselves in uncharted territory. Each member can grieve differently, expressing their sorrow in various ways.

It's crucial to understand that there is no acceptable way to grieve. Some individuals may express their grief openly, while others prefer to process it more privately. Open communication within the family can help create a safe and supportive environment where each member feels enabled to share their feelings without pressure.

Listen attentively with one another, acknowledge each other's emotions, and provide support in whatever form feels most helpful.

Remember that grief is a path that takes time. Be patient with yourselves and one another as you move through this painful experience. Seeking professional guidance from a therapist or grief counselor can provide valuable help in coping with loss and moving forward.

Facing Financial Challenges Together

Financial hardships can challenge even the closest of bonds. However, remember that you don't have to tackle these difficulties in isolation. By sharing openly and honestly with your partner, you can create a common plan to navigate these turbulent times.

  • Talk frankly with your family members and examine your income and expenses.
  • Team up to formulate a realistic budget that focuses on essential needs.
  • Consider ways to supplement your income.
  • Consult professional counseling if needed.

Remember, you are not alone. By working, you can triumph over these financial challenges and emerge stronger.
